Ridgestone Bank Receives Top SBA Award

July 02, 2014
BROOKFIELD, Wis.– Ridgestone Bank received the Wisconsin SBA Volume Lender Award at the 25th Annual Lender’s Conference in the Wisconsin Dells last month.  Ridgestone Bank’s Wisconsin SBA loans totaled $46.8 million in fiscal 2013.
 
“I am pleased with the achievements of our team,” said Bruce Lammers, president and CEO of Ridgestone Bank. “Our focus continues to be on government guaranteed loans for small and mid-sized businesses throughout Wisconsin and the Midwest.  It’s always good to see the number of customers we have been able to help through alternative lending options utilizing SBA loan programs.”
 
Ridgestone Bank is a privately-held bank with locations in Brookfield, Wis. and Schaumburg, Ill., as well as lending teams in Indianapolis, Green Bay, Wis. and Wausau, Wis. Founded in 1995, the bank is a leader in small business and government guaranteed lending nationwide and also provides retail banking services, including checking, money markets, CD’s, and other convenience services at its branch locations.  Distinguished by the SBA as an “SBA Preferred Lender,” Ridgestone Bank is the 7th most prolific SBA lender in the nation is the number one SBA lender in Illinois and is the number one SBA lender in its asset size in Wisconsin.  Ridgestone Bank is a leader in USDA lending in the United States and has been recognized as a valued partner by the USDA for its commitment to small businesses.  For more information, call 262-789-1011 or visit www.ridgestone.com.
